C++ - jak skutecznie poznać język programowania Porady i wskazówki dla początkujących
1. Jak skutecznie zacząć naukę C++?
Nauka języka programowania C++ może być wyzwaniem, ale jeśli zacznie się odpowiednio, można go szybko opanować. Aby zacząć skutecznie naukę C++, trzeba mieć dobry plan i znaleźć odpowiednie narzędzia.
Pierwszą rzeczą, którą należy zrobić, jest ustalenie celu nauki. Należy wybrać konkretny projekt, który chcesz osiągnąć. Może to być prosta aplikacja do wyszukiwania informacji lub gra video. Określenie celu pomoże Ci lepiej zorganizować swoją naukę i lepiej zrozumieć to, czego się uczyć.
Kolejnym krokiem jest wybranie kursu lub książki, które pomogą Ci w nauce. Wybierając materiały edukacyjne, należy upewnić się, że są one odpowiednie dla Twojego poziomu zaawansowania oraz odpowiadają Twoim celom. W przypadku kursów online warto sprawdzić opinie innych uczestników i upewnić się, że są one przejrzyste i zawierają wszystkie potrzebne informacje.
Kolejnym ważnym krokiem jest znalezienie dobrego środowiska programistycznego. To narzędzie pozwala na tworzenie i uruchamianie programów napisanych w C++. Istnieje wiele darmowych środowisk programistycznych dostępnych dla C++, takich jak Visual Studio Code czy Eclipse. Wybór środowiska powinien być oparty na Twoich potrzebach i preferencjach.
Następnym ważnym krokiem jest ćwiczenie i powtarzanie tego, co się uczy. Najlepiej jest tworzyć małe programy podczas nauki nowych funkcji i zasad języka. To pozwala na utrwalenie wiedzy oraz pomaga zrozumieć, jak działają poszczególne elementy języka.
Na końcu warto poszukać społeczności programistów i dyskusji na forach internetowych lub grupach na portalach społecznościowych, aby poprosić o porady lub odpowiedzi na pytania dotyczące C++. Znalezienie społeczności programistów może pomóc Ci utrzymać motywację do nauki i uczenia się nowych rzeczy oraz może pomóc w rozwiązywaniu problemów podczas tworzenia aplikacji.
Nauka C++ może być trudna, ale jeśli zaczniesz odpowiednio, możesz szybko osiągnąć sukces. Przed rozpoczęciem nauki ważne jest ustalenie celu oraz znalezienie odpowiednich materiałów edukacyjnych i narzędzi programistycznych. Następnie należy ćwiczyć regularnie i uczyć się nowych rzeczy oraz szukać wsparcia w społeczności programistów. Dzięki tym krokom skuteczna nauka C++ będzie dużo łatwiejsza i szybsza!
2. Co trzeba wiedzieć, aby rozpocząć programowanie w C++?
Programowanie w C++ to jeden z najpopularniejszych języków programowania, z którym spotyka się wielu programistów, zarówno początkujących, jak i doświadczonych. Aby rozpocząć programowanie w C++, powinieneś mieć podstawowe pojęcie o tym jak działa komputer i ogólne pojęcie o programowaniu. Jeśli masz już te podstawy, możesz zacząć przygodę z C++.
Przede wszystkim musisz nauczyć się podstaw składni języka. Jest to kluczowa część, ponieważ składnia C++ jest bardziej skomplikowana niż inne języki. Musisz poznać typy danych, instrukcje sterujące, operatory, funkcje i biblioteki. Musisz także wiedzieć, jak tworzyć klasy i obiekty, a także jak je wykorzystać do tworzenia aplikacji.
Kolejnym ważnym elementem nauki programowania w C++ jest zrozumienie zasady działania bibliotek i narzędzi programistycznych. Po nauczeniu się składni języka będziesz musiał poznać zasady działania narzędzi takich jak Visual Studio czy Eclipse, aby móc tworzyć swoje aplikacje. Biblioteki służą do wykonywania określonych czynności i można je wykorzystać do tworzenia aplikacji.
Na koniec musisz poznać narzędzie debugowania. Debugowanie polega na analizowaniu kodu i odkrywaniu błędów, które mogą się pojawić podczas tworzenia aplikacji. Narzędzie debugowania pomoże Ci naprawić błędy i poprawić swoje aplikacje.
Podsumowując, aby rozpocząć programowanie w C++, musisz mieć podstawowe pojęcie o tym jak działa komputer i ogólne pojęcie o programowaniu. Musisz także nauczyć się podstaw składni języka, poznawać narzędzie programistyczne i biblioteki oraz narzędzie debugowania. Z takim fundamentem możesz stworzyć swoje pierwsze aplikacje w C++.
3. Jak zrozumieć podstawy C++?
C++ jest językiem programowania wykorzystywanym w wielu dziedzinach, od tworzenia aplikacji po tworzenie gier. Chociaż może on wydawać się skomplikowany, to jego podstawy są całkiem proste. Aby zrozumieć podstawy C++, ważne jest, aby zrozumieć podstawy programowania i składni języka.
Pierwszym krokiem do zrozumienia C++ jest zrozumienie składni języka. Składnia jest używana do określania, w jaki sposób kod jest napisany. C++ wykorzystuje składnię zbliżoną do składni innych języków programowania, takich jak Java lub C#. W C++ istnieje również szereg skrótów i symboli, które są używane do oznaczania różnych typów danych i funkcji.
Kolejnym krokiem jest zrozumienie podstaw programowania. Programowanie polega na napisaniu kodu, który będzie działać w określony sposób. Kod ten może być używany do tworzenia aplikacji lub gier. Aby skutecznie pisać w C++, ważne jest, aby zrozumieć podstawowe elementy programowania, takie jak zmienne, pętle, instrukcje warunkowe i funkcje.
Kolejnym ważnym krokiem jest poznanie bibliotek C++. Biblioteki to gotowe funkcje i narzędzia, które mogą być użyte do tworzenia aplikacji lub gier. Biblioteki są dostarczane wraz z C++ i są bardzo przydatne w tworzeniu aplikacji i gier.
Ostatnim ważnym krokiem jest poznanie narzędzi do tworzenia oprogramowania. Te narzędzia służą do tworzenia aplikacji lub gier za pomocą C++. Narzędzia te mogą być używane do tworzenia aplikacji na różne platformy, takie jak Windows, MacOS lub Linux. Niektóre narzędzia mogą również być używane do tworzenia gier na komputery PC lub konsole do gier.
Aby zrozumieć podstawy C++, ważne jest, aby nauczyć się składni i podstaw programowania oraz poznać biblioteki i narzędzia do tworzenia oprogramowania. Ważne jest również, aby poświęcić czas na samodzielne ćwiczenie napisania aplikacji lub gry w C++ oraz przejrzenie gotowego kodu innych programistów. Gdy już opanujesz podstawy C++, możesz przejść dalej i nauczyć się bardziej zaawansowanych technik programowania w tym języku.
4. Przydatne narzędzia i zasoby do nauki C++
C++ jest jednym z najpopularniejszych języków programowania, a nauka tego języka może być trudnym zadaniem. Na szczęście istnieje wiele przydatnych narzędzi i zasobów, które mogą pomóc w nauce C++. Jednym z takich narzędzi jest platforma edukacyjna Coursera. Ta platforma oferuje kursy od podstaw do zaawansowanych poziomów, a także różne projekty do samodzielnego wykonania. Kursy te mają często wykłady wideo, laboratoria i ćwiczenia, aby pomóc uczniom w lepszym zrozumieniu tematu.
Kolejnym przydatnym narzędziem jest strona internetowa CPlusPlus.com. Ta strona internetowa oferuje szeroką gamę materiałów edukacyjnych, w tym podręczniki, tutoriale, artykuły i kody źródłowe. Ta strona internetowa jest bardzo przydatna dla uczniów, którzy chcą nauczyć się C++ w swoim wolnym czasie, ponieważ zawiera ona informacje na temat wszystkich głównych funkcji języka.
Kolejnym przydatnym narzędziem do nauki C++ jest YouTube. Na tym kanału można znaleźć filmy instruktażowe i tutoriale na temat C++, a także ćwiczenia, które mogą pomóc uczniom w ich nauce. Wiele filmów na temat C++ ma również komentarze i recenzje innych użytkowników, które mogą być pomocne dla uczniów w ich nauce.
Ostatnim przydatnym narzędziem do nauki C++ jest strona internetowa Stack Overflow. Ta strona internetowa zawiera wiele pytań dotyczących C++ i odpowiedzi na te pytania od innych użytkowników. Pytania te mogą dotyczyć wszystkiego od podstawowych problemów do bardziej zaawansowanych pytań dotyczących języka. Strona ta może być bardzo przydatna dla osób, które chcą dowiedzieć się więcej o programowaniu w C++.
Podsumowując, istnieje wiele przydatnych narzędzi i zasobów do nauki C++, a każdy z nich może być pomocny dla osób rozpoczynających swoją przygodę z tym językiem. Platforma edukacyjna Coursera, strona internetowa CPlusPlus.com, kanał YouTube i strona internetowa Stack Overflow to tylko niektóre z tych przydatnych narzędzi. Uczniowie powinni skorzystać z tych narzędzi, aby szybciej się uczyć i bardziej efektywnie pracować nad swoimi projektami.
5. Jak przekuć wiedzę w umiejętności programowania w C++?
Programowanie w języku C++ jest szerokim i skomplikowanym tematem, a wiedza i umiejętności potrzebne do programowania w tym języku można przekuć na sukces. Aby to zrobić, trzeba najpierw poznać podstawy języka C++. Jeśli jesteś nowicjuszem, skup się na nauce podstaw, takich jak składnia, zmienne i konstrukcje programistyczne. Następnie poznaj biblioteki, które mogą być używane do tworzenia programów w C++. Po zapoznaniu się z tymi podstawami, można przejść do bardziej złożonych koncepcji, takich jak programowanie obiektowe i strukturalne.
Kiedy już poznasz podstawy języka C++, możesz nauczyć się korzystać z narzędzi programistycznych i oprogramowania wspierającego tworzenie programów w C++. To obejmuje oprogramowanie do debugowania, projektowania i edytowania kodu oraz narzędzia do tworzenia i testowania aplikacji. Im więcej narzędzi masz, tym lepiej rozumiesz dany język programowania i możesz szybciej tworzyć i testować swoje aplikacje.
Gdy już poznasz podstawy C++, możesz rozważyć naukę bardziej zaawansowanych technik programowania. Obejmuje to różne strategie optymalizacji kodu i bardziej złożone struktury danych. Możesz także poznać algorytmy optymalizacji i metody tworzenia aplikacji wielowątkowych.
Dobrym sposobem na przekucie wiedzy na umiejętności programowania w C++ jest praktyka. Należy spróbować napisać kilka prostych programów, aby poczuć się swobodnie przy tworzeniu aplikacji w tym języku. Możesz także spróbować rozwiązać problemy innych programistów lub rozwiązać określone problemy programistyczne na platformach społecznościowych dla programistów.
Aby mieć sukces w programowaniu w języku C++, musisz ciągle się uczyć. Należy poznawać nowe techniki i algorytmy oraz stale testować swoje umiejętności poprzez tworzenie aplikacji. To pomoże Ci zdobywać coraz większe doświadczenie w tworzeniu aplikacji w tym języku i przekuwać Twoją wiedzę na umiejętności programowania w C++.
6. Jak stworzyć swój pierwszy program w C++?
Jeśli chcesz rozpocząć przygodę z programowaniem w języku C++, to dobrze trafiłeś. Jest to świetny język, który może być używany do tworzenia wszelkiego rodzaju programów. Aby stworzyć swój pierwszy program w C++, należy wykonać kilka prostych kroków.
Po pierwsze, musisz mieć dostęp do środowiska programistycznego. Środowiska te oferują narzędzia do tworzenia, debugowania i uruchamiania programów napisanych w języku C++. Najpopularniejszymi środowiskami są Microsoft Visual Studio, Borland C++ Builder i Code::Blocks.
Po drugie, musisz zapoznać się z podstawami języka C++. Aby stworzyć swój pierwszy program w C++, powinieneś znać podstawy konstrukcji języka, takie jak typy danych, operatory, funkcje i struktury danych. Możesz skorzystać z książki lub tutorialu internetowego, aby dowiedzieć się więcej na temat składni i semantyki języka C++.
Po trzecie, musisz pisać kod. Po nauczeniu się podstaw języka C++ możesz przejść do napisania kodu Twojego pierwszego programu. Najlepiej jest zacząć od prostego programu, np. programu Hello World, który wypisuje napis „Hello World” na ekranie. Kiedy już napiszesz swój pierwszy program w C++, możesz spróbować napisać bardziej zaawansowane programy.
Po czwarte, musisz skompilować swój kod. Kompilacja polega na przekonwertowaniu kodu napisanego w języku C++ na postać binarną, która może być wykonywana przez maszynę. Do tego celu należy użyć narzędzi oferowanych przez środowisko programistyczne.
Po piąte i ostatnie, musisz uruchomić swój program. Po skompilowaniu swojego programu możesz go uruchomić za pomocą narzędzi oferowanych przez środowisko programistyczne lub poprzez wiersz poleceń. Jeśli wszystko poszło dobrze, powinieneś zobaczyć rezultat działania swojego programu na ekranie.
Tworzenie swojego pierwszego programu w C++ może być zabawnym i ekscytującym doświadczeniem. Wykonanie powyższych pięciu kroków pomoże Ci stworzyć swój pierwszy program w C++ i rozpoczniesz swoje przygody z programowaniem!